    The 2017 Pepsi and Kendall Jenner ad is a textbook case of influencer marketing gone wrong. The commercial staged a Black Lives Matter protest for Pepsi’s global diversity campaign, featuring Jenner leaving a photoshoot to join the protest and offering a Pepsi to a police officer. This act was intended to symbolize unity but was widely criticized for trivializing a serious movement.

    Bernice King, daughter of Martin Luther King Jr., mocked up an ad with a tweet of her father confronting police, captioned, “If only Daddy would have known about the power of #Pepsi.” After the backlash, Pepsi pulled the ad and apologized, highlighting the importance of choosing the right influencer and message alignment to avoid damaging your brand.

How to Measure the Impact of Your Social Media Engagement

Assessing the impact of social media engagement on your business involves tracking key metrics that reflect audience interaction and content effectiveness:

  • Engagement Rate

    This metric helps determine how actively your audience interacts with your content. Engagement rate is typically calculated by dividing the total post interactions by the number of followers, reach, or impressions, then multiplying by 100%. The formula can vary depending on the platform, but it generally provides a good gauge of audience activity.

  • Reach and Impressions

    Reach refers to the number of unique users who view your post, while impressions denote the total number of times your post is displayed. These metrics are crucial for understanding the overall visibility and potential audience of your content.

  • Click-Through Rate (CTR)

    This is the percentage of users who click on a link in your post. CTR is essential for assessing the effectiveness of calls to action in your content, whether you’re directing users to a website, blog post, or product page.

  • Shares and Brand Mentions

    Monitoring the number of shares and mentions your posts receive can give insights into how well your content resonates with your audience. Content that is frequently shared often indicates higher engagement and wider reach.

  • Video Views and Watch Time

    For platforms like Y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ok, it’s important to track how many users watch your video content and the duration of their viewing. These metrics can indicate the appeal and relevance of your videos to your audience.

  • Conversion Rate

    This measures the frequency at which users take a desired action—such as signing up for a newsletter or making a purchase—after engaging with your content. It connects your social media efforts directly to business results.

Social Media Frequency Checklist

How often should you follow a social media checklist? Should it be daily, weekly, or monthly? While doing everything daily would be ideal, it’s not practical for most brands.

Social Media Frequency Guide

To help clients determine the optimal frequency, we categorize our checklists into two main categories — inbound and outbound social media activities.

  1. Inbound Social Media Engagement

    This involves responding to comments and messages received by your brand on social media platforms, such as replying to direct messages on Facebook. Inbound engagement includes managing positive feedback and addressing customer concerns or complaints.

    Ideal Frequency: This type of engagement is critical and should ideally be monitored daily. Allocating a few minutes each day to interact with your audience is recommended as they are actively engaging with your brand.

  2. Outbound Social Media Engagement

    This refers to actively seeking and participating in social media conversations, like joining discussions around trending hashtags. Unlike inbound engagement, which is essential for maintaining your brand’s reputation, outbound activities are more flexible and can be pursued based on available resources.

    Ideal Frequency: These activities can be scheduled in advance. For brands aiming to cultivate an engaged social media presence, dedicating time 2-3 times a week to outbound engagement is advisable.

How to View Instagram Memories: A Step-by-Step Guide

Introduction

Instagram is not just a platform for sharing your daily moments but also a repository of cherished memories.

In 2018, Instagram introduced a feature called “Memories” (similar to Facebook’s “On This Day”) that allows you to revisit and relive your old posts.

If you’re curious about how to view Instagram Memories, you’re in the right place. In this step-by-step guide, we’ll walk you through accessing and enjoying your past moments on Instagram.

9 Easy Steps on How To View Instagram Memories

Let’s highlight easy steps that will help you to view Instagram memories.

  • Step 1: Open the Instagram App

    Start by opening the Instagram app on your smartphone. Ensure you are logged in to the account you want to access memories.

    open instagram app

  • Step 2: Go to Your Profile

    Tap on your profile picture or the silhouette icon in the bottom right corner to access your profile page. This is where you’ll find all the posts you’ve ever shared on Instagram.

    go to profile

  • Step 3: Access Memories

    Now, on your profile page, you’ll notice a clock-like icon with an arrow around it at the top right corner of the screen. This is the “Memories” icon. Tap on it.

    Access Memories

  • Step 4: Explore Your Memories

    After tapping the Memories icon, Instagram will take you to the “On This Day” page. Here, you’ll see a collage of posts you shared on the same date in previous years. Scroll down to explore different memories from various years.

    Tip: If you’d like to create your own custom memories, try using collage generator to combine your favorite moments.

    Explore Your Memories

  • Step 5: Interact with Your Memories

    Instagram Memories allows you to interact with your old posts just like you would with current ones. You can like, comment, and share these memories with your followers if your privacy settings permit.

    Interact with Memories

  • Step 6: Share Memories in Your Story

    If you want to share a specific memory with your Instagram story, tap the Share icon (a paper airplane) beneath the post. You can add stickers, text, or drawings to make it more personalized before sharing it with your story.

    share memories in story

  • Step 7: Save Memories

    Tap the Save icon (a downward arrow) below the post to save memory to your device’s photo library. This way, you can keep a copy of your cherished moments offline.

    Save Memories

  • Step 8: Access Older Memories

    To explore memories from earlier years, tap the calendar icon at the top right of the “On This Day” page. This will allow you to select a specific date and see memories from that day in the past.

    access older memories

  • Step 9: Adjust Your Memory Notifications

    Instagram also lets you set up notifications to receive daily reminders of your past posts. To do this, tap the three horizontal lines at the top right corner of your profile, go to “Settings,” then select “Privacy,” and finally, “Memories.” From here, you can adjust your memory notification preferences.

What is an Instagram Carousel Post?

An Instagram Carousel Post is multimedia content that allows users to share multiple photos and videos within a single post.

Unlike a regular Instagram post that typically features just one image or video, a carousel post lets you swipe through a series of images or videos horizontally, similar to a slideshow.

Here are the key features and characteristics of an Instagram Carousel Post:

  • Multiple Content Pieces: Carousel posts can include up to 10 photos or videos in a single post. Each image or video is considered a separate content piece.
  • Swipeable Format: Users can swipe left or right to navigate the images or videos within the carousel.
  • Individual Captions and Hashtags: You can assign unique captions, emojis, and hashtags to each image or video in the carousel. This allows you to provide context, tell a story, or share specific information related to each piece of content.
  • Variety and Creativity: Carousel posts offer an opportunity to showcase various content, such as product images, behind-the-scenes glimpses, step-by-step tutorials, customer testimonials, event highlights, and more.
  • Engagement and Interaction: Followers can engage with each piece of content within the carousel by liking, commenting, or sharing. This can encourage more interaction and discussions compared to a single-image post.
  • Increased Visibility: Carousel posts have the potential to reach a larger audience and gain higher engagement due to the multiple images or videos they contain. They also provide an opportunity to incorporate a diverse range of hashtags, which can enhance discoverability.
  • Storytelling and Narrative: Carousel posts are often used for storytelling, allowing users to present a sequence of images that tell a complete narrative or convey a specific message.

Carousel posts provide a versatile and engaging way to share content on Instagram, allowing you to showcase your creativity, tell stories, and connect with your audience more interactively.

What is a Blue Tick on Facebook?

The blue tick on Facebook is a verification badge that appears next to the name of a profile or page. It symbolizes authenticity and credibility, indicating that the account represents a real person, registered business, or entity of public interest.

The blue tick helps users identify legitimate profiles or pages from impersonators, fan accounts, or unofficial entities. It adds more trust and credibility to the verified account, particularly for public figures, brands, and businesses on the platform.

  6. Make a Verification Request

    Once you have established a strong presence on Instagram and fulfilled the requirements, it’s time to submit a verification request.

    To do this, go to your account settings, click “Request Verification,” and provide the required information.

    Instagram will ask you to provide your account username, full name, and supporting documents, such as a government-issued photo ID, business documents, or media articles about you.

    verification request

    To make it easier for you, let’s go through straightforward steps to get verified on Instagram.

    • First, open Instagram on your Android mobile phone or iPhone.

      Open Instagram Account

    • Just navigate to your profile icon from the bottom tab.

      click on instagram profile

    • Select the ‘hamburger menu’ from the top right corner tap ‘Settings and privacy.’

      Select the hamburger menu
      tap settings and privacy

    • Scroll down and select ‘Account type and tools.’

      select account type and tools

    • Now, select ‘Request verification.’

      request verification

    • Fill out the form by adding personal details and links to articles that present you as a notable figure. You can also add links to your other social media handles.

      Fill Up Form

    • Once done, hit ‘Submit,’ and your application will be processed.

      click on submit

    Apart from this verification method, another method for getting verified on Instagram, known as the paid version, is “Meta Verified.”

    • Open Instagram on your Android mobile phone or iPhone.

      Open Instagram Account

    • Tap on your profile icon from the bottom tab.

      click on instagram profile

    • Now select the ‘hamburger menu’ from the top right corner.

      Select the hamburger menu

    • From here, tap ‘Meta Verified.’

      tap meta verified

    • If it says ‘Join the waiting list’ up top, it means Meta Verified has not yet been enabled for your account.

      join waiting list

    • However, if the next screen shows a ‘Subscribe’ button, you’re good to go and can get a blue tick by providing identity proof and making the payment.

      select subscribe button

    • If you wish to subscribe, select the ‘Pay now’ button on the next screen, and you will be prompted to pay Rs 699 per month through Google Play on Android, while on iPhone, the payment can be made through App Store for the same amount.

      Pay to get benefits

    • Once you’re done with the payment, Instagram will ask for your identity proof which can be fulfilled by submitting a government ID. It will also ask for a selfie video to verify you’re real.

      submitting id proof

    • Since it’s a subscription, you will be automatically charged monthly. Make sure to cancel the subscription through Play Store or App Store settings to discontinue the verification badge.

      Cancel subscription

Be Patient and Persistent

Once you submit the verification request, the best part is to be patient; the process can take some time.

Instagram receives many verification requests, so it may take several weeks or months to respond. If your request is denied, don’t be discouraged.

Take time to evaluate your account and work on areas needing improvement. You can submit another request after 30 days.

Some Important Things To Note

  • Ensure your username is what you’d like before applying for a verified badge. Once verified, you may not change the username on your account.

  • Suppose you receive a verified badge using false or misleading information during the verification process. In that case, the Instagram team might remove your verified badge and take additional action to deactivate your account.
